Output e0ae26224255577fe7815a5be93d6bba23b9a99e341752cd80c06a1a459a0fdf:1

value
57750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67bdbb7ccb03b20a188c76e5c2d6450e49ac014c OP_EQUAL
address
MHMh82Qhhxw4ihUjSMzqBXGy6UBhjs8AtK
transaction
e0ae26224255577fe7815a5be93d6bba23b9a99e341752cd80c06a1a459a0fdf
spent
true